Tyontyuppo
Tyontyuppo is a sound in South Jeolla, South Korea. Tyontyuppo is situated nearby to the locality Dangdo, as well as near Hwalmok.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Jodo-myeon
Town
Jodo-myeon is a myeon in Jindo County of South Jeolla Province, South Korea. The township office is in Changyu-ri on Hajodo. There are 177 islands on the sea off Jodo-myeon. Jodo-myeon is situated 4 km west of Tyontyuppo.
